𝗠𝗮𝗿𝗶𝗻𝗲 𝗖𝗮𝗿𝗴𝗼 𝗜𝗻𝘀𝘂𝗿𝗮𝗻𝗰𝗲 𝗳𝗼𝗿 𝗟𝗼𝗴𝗶𝘀𝘁𝗶𝗰𝘀 𝗖𝗼𝗺𝗽𝗮𝗻𝗶𝗲𝘀
Logistics companies manage the full chain — inland trucking from the factory, warehousing, port handling, and last-mile delivery — for cargo ranging from textiles and FMCG to minerals and machinery, moving between origin cities like Tirupur, Ludhiana, Morbi, and Rajasthan and the gateway ports of Mundra, JNPT, and Kandla.
𝗧𝗵𝗲 𝗿𝗲𝗮𝗹 𝗽𝗿𝗼𝗯𝗹𝗲𝗺 𝗹𝗼𝗴𝗶𝘀𝘁𝗶𝗰𝘀 𝗰𝗼𝗺𝗽𝗮𝗻𝗶𝗲𝘀 𝗿𝘂𝗻 𝗶𝗻𝘁𝗼:
A logistics company managing factory-to-port trucking for an export client had a truck involved in an accident en route to Mundra, damaging a portion of the load. The client had insured the ocean leg only, assuming the logistics company's own transporter cover applied to the full cargo value — it did not, and the shortfall became a dispute between the client and the logistics company's transport partner.
𝗛𝗼𝘄 𝗖𝗮𝗿𝗴𝗼𝗖𝗼𝘃𝗲𝗿 𝗰𝘂𝗿𝗲𝘀 𝗶𝘁:
CargoCover structures a single Marine Open Cover policy on a warehouse-to-warehouse basis — covering factory, inland transit, warehousing, and ocean transit as one continuous risk under ICC A, 110% CIF, with War and SRCC included — so there's no gap between the inland leg and the ocean leg for the logistics company to get caught in the middle of.

𝗧𝗵𝗲 𝗿𝗲𝗮𝗹𝗶𝘁𝘆:
Cargo damaged on the inland leg is one of the most common uninsured losses in Indian exports, because shippers assume ocean cover starts and ends at the port. A single continuous marine policy removes that gap and the disputes that come with it.
